What can help me grasp things if my hands are weak from arthritis?

Wear rubber gloves to make it easier for weak hands to grasp objects. They also help protect your hands from chemicals when cleaning and from the cold when handling frozen or refrigerated foods. To make the gloves easier to put on and take off, sprinkle a little cornstarch inside each one.

If they’re still difficult to remove, try holding your hands under cold water and then pulling them off. If one of the gloves gets a hole in it (usually the one for your dominant hand), keep the mate. The next time another dominant-hand glove wears out, turn the mate you saved inside out and you’ll have a “new” pair of gloves.

If gloves are too difficult to use, try slipping your hands into plastic bags; if necessary, secure around your wrist with a large rubber band.
